Publisher's summary

Private Investigator Gaia Charmer brings new meaning to the words "Earth Angel".

This mysterious (and bipolar) bombshell has the power of the Earth itself at her fingertips, but the murder of her best friend knocks her world off its axis.

Out for blood on the killer’s trail, Gaia and a tough-as-nails sheriff must overcome Landkind — a secret society of movers and shakers with influence over Earthly landforms — and a vicious enemy with the key to her true identity.

Don't miss the start of an Urban Fantasy adventure filled with elemental magic and a kickass heroine you can't help but root for. It's perfect for fans of Buffy the Vampire Slayer, The Chilling Adventures of Sabrina, and the Mercy Thompson series.

This was a book I requested from Aethon audio and the review is voluntary. Wow! This is one book that is amazing from the first sentence to the last! Unique, intriguing, and fresh! Our main character is a gal of the earth. She can manipulate stones, rocks, and gravel. A rock star! She works as a travel agent and a private investigator for those not human, the Landkind. There are several in this story such as a whole named mountain range, but the avatar is a woman that comes to Gaia for help. Someone is poisoning her, the mountains, and she wants the killer found.
Gaia can't remember her further back than a few years. This, the murderer of her friend and the land, and more small mysteries plague her.
The ending was very unexpected and I can't wait to find out what happens next!
These are well developed characters, very unusual, and likeable! The plot is great! Keeping me guessing! Gaia has flashes of memories that tease the reader as to what she might be. Fresh fantastic fantasy!
The narrator performed so well I thought there was two narrators! Great job!
